How do you clean kitchen cabinets with Murphy’s soap?

First, start by wiping down all of your kitchen cabinets with a damp, soapy cloth. You can use liquid dish detergent and warm water to make a light soap mixture. Wipe them down one-by-one, going over each cabinet exterior.

If you have any accumulated grease buildup, use a damp sponge to scrub it away.

Once you have thoroughly wiped down your kitchen cabinets, it is time to apply Murphy’s Soap. Before applying, make sure to read the label for any specific instructions regarding use. Once you have read the instructions, pour a couple of drops of Murphy’s soap on a damp sponge.

Gently scrub your cabinets, starting from the top and moving towards the bottom.

Once you have applied the soap, rinse the sponge and start wiping the cabinets dry. Make sure to ensure that all of the residues are removed. After that, rinse the sponge again and wipe down one last time to make sure it’s all gone.

Once finished, you can take a few moments to admire your newly restored kitchen cabinets!

Do you have to rinse off Murphy’s oil soap?

Yes, you should rinse off Murphy’s oil soap after using it to clean surfaces. This is to ensure that there is no residue left behind. When using Murphy’s oil soap it is important to add a few drops of the cleaning solution to a damp sponge or cloth, never use the solution undiluted or apply it directly to a surface.

Once you have finished cleaning the surface, rinse it with clean water, a damp cloth can help remove any excess soap residue. You should also use a wet/dry vacuum to remove any remaining residue. Finally, dry the surface thoroughly to prevent streaking.

How do you clean wood cabinets without damaging the finish?

When cleaning wood cabinets, it is important to not use products that are too harsh or abrasive, as this can damage the finish. Start by dusting your cabinets with a dry microfiber cloth to remove any surface dirt and dust.

If the cabinets are heavily soiled, you can use a slightly damp cloth with mild dish soap. Avoid abrasive cleaners like steel wool or harsh scrubbers, as this can scratch and damage the finish. After cleaning with soap and water, make sure to dry the cabinets with a clean cloth to avoid leaving any water streaks.

Depending on the type of finish, you may need to apply a furniture cleaner or oil. For most finishes, you can use a cleaner or oil specifically designed to protect the wood and add shine. Before using any cleaners or oils, make sure to test them in an inconspicuous spot to ensure that the finish isn’t damaged.

How do you clean painted cabinets?

Cleaning painted cabinets requires special care to avoid damaging the paint finish. The best way to clean painted cabinets is to use mild soap and warm water and a soft cloth. Start by wiping the cabinets down with a damp cloth to get rid of any dust or debris.

Then make a cleaning solution with a tablespoon of dish soap and a quart of warm water. Be sure to test a small area of the cabinet to make sure the cleaning solution does not damage the paint finish.

After testing a small section of the cabinet and confirming it is safe to use, start cleaning each cabinet with the solution and a soft cloth, wiping in the direction of the grain. Rinse the cloth often and use a new cloth when necessary.

Once the cabinets are clean and free of dirt, grease and grime, use a dry, soft cloth to dry them off. For more stubborn dirt and grease, try using a mixture of baking soda and water and a soft brush before using the mild soap and water solution.

How do you use Murphy’s concentrated wood cleaner on cabinets?

Using Murphy’s Concentrated Wood Cleaner on cabinets is a great way to bring out the natural beauty of wood surfaces. To begin, clean the cabinets with water, using a mild detergent if needed. Then, prepare Murphy’s Concentrated Wood Cleaner by diluting one part cleaner to four parts water.

After mixing, apply to the cabinets using a soft, lint-free cloth. Gently rub in a circular motion and allow the cleaner to penetrate the wood, then wipe off any excess cleaner with the same cloth. Rinse the cloth and wipe down the cabinets, removing any cleaner residue.

The cabinets should now be clean, conditioned and have a beautiful finish.

Why are my kitchen cabinets sticky after cleaning?

The most likely culprit is that you’ve used the wrong cleaning product. For example, some cleaning products are too strong or harsh and can leave behind a residue that makes your cabinets sticky.

In addition, if you’ve used too much cleaner and haven’t properly wiped it off, it can leave behind a sticky residue. Some cleaning products also contain fragrances, oils, and/or waxes that can make your cabinets sticky.

You can also have a sticky residue if you haven’t dried the cabinets thoroughly after cleaning. Moisture can create a humid environment inside your cabinets, which can make them sticky over time.

In some cases, your kitchen cabinets may have been tainted with oily substances such as cooking grease, which can also make them sticky. If this is the cause, you’ll need to use a cleaning product specifically designed for grease removal.

Finally, it’s possible that you didn’t properly remove the dirt from your cabinets before you applied the cleaning product. In this case, the dirt may have acted as a barrier between the cleaning product and the surface of the cabinets, resulting in a sticky residue.
